开发者社区> 问答> 正文

这个OceanBase数据库两集群的主从复制因该怎么配置?

这个OceanBase数据库两集群的主从复制因该怎么配置?
5925e7bfb13d51299e28361f6fb19b35.png

展开
收起
乐天香橙派 2024-03-11 22:10:11 236 0
来自:OceanBase
2 条回答
写回答
取消 提交回答
  • OceanBase数据库的两集群主从复制配置通常涉及到将一个集群的数据复制到另一个集群,以确保数据的高可用性和灾难恢复能力。以下是配置OceanBase数据库两集群主从复制的基本步骤:

    1. 准备两个OceanBase集群:确保您有两个正常运行的OceanBase数据库集群,每个集群都应该包含至少一个租户(Tenant)和相应的数据。
    2. 配置数据复制软件:您需要使用数据复制软件来实现两个集群之间的数据同步。这个软件应该能够监控主集群的数据变化,并将这些变化实时或定期地复制到从集群。
    3. 设置主集群和从集群:在数据复制软件中,指定其中一个集群作为主集群(Master),另一个作为从集群(Slave)。主集群的数据将被复制到从集群。
    4. 配置复制策略:根据业务需求和数据一致性要求,配置数据复制的策略。这可能包括全量复制、增量复制或双向复制等。
    5. 启动数据复制:完成配置后,启动数据复制过程。确保复制软件能够正确执行,并且两个集群之间的网络连接稳定。
    6. 验证复制效果:通过在主集群上进行数据操作,检查从集群是否能够正确接收并应用这些变更,以验证复制是否成功。
    7. 监控复制状态:持续监控两个集群的复制状态,确保数据一致性,并在发现问题时及时处理。

    请注意,以上步骤是一般性的描述,具体操作可能需要参考OceanBase的官方文档或咨询技术支持,以获取更详细的指导。在配置过程中,务必注意数据安全和系统稳定性,避免在生产环境中出现数据丢失或服务中断的情况。

    2024-03-12 09:55:22
    赞同 展开评论 打赏
  • 要配置OceanBase数据库的两个集群进行主从复制,您需要按照以下步骤进行:

    1. 部署两个集群:确保每个机房都部署了一个OceanBase集群,一个作为主库(Master),另一个作为备库(Slave)。
    2. 配置Paxos组:每个集群应该有自己单独的Paxos组,以保证多副本之间的一致性。
    3. 设置主从复制:在数据库层面,可以通过RedoLog来进行数据同步,这是实现主从复制的一种方式。
    4. 创建租户:可以在两个集群上创建相同的租户,例如名为tenant_test的租户,以便进行数据库操作。
    5. 调整集群配置:通过设置集群配置项,可以控制集群的负载均衡、合并时间、合并方式等参数,这些参数可以是动态生效或重启后生效。
    6. 部署位置:主备集群可以部署在不同的地理位置,以满足业务不同级别的需求。

    总的来说,在进行配置时,请确保遵循OceanBase的官方文档和最佳实践,以确保配置的正确性和系统的稳定性。此外,建议在非生产环境中先行测试配置,以验证复制功能是否正常工作,避免对生产环境造成影响。

    2024-03-12 09:42:42
    赞同 展开评论 打赏
来源圈子
更多
收录在圈子:
+ 订阅
蚂蚁OceanBase数据库团队,用于OceanBase技术原理、运维经验和案例分享、对外交流。
问答排行榜
最热
最新

相关电子书

更多
开源HTAP OceanBase产品揭秘 立即下载
云数据库OceanBase 架构演进及在金融核心系统中的实践 立即下载
自研金融数据库OceanBase的创新之路 立即下载